Riding for KeepsBy Michael LeavertonPublished on July 12, 2008 at 4:21amEvery summer, the Tour de Fat bike festival rolls through many bike-friendly places Portland, Austin, Durango pitches some beer tents, and has a party. That's not the worst thing in the world. Today it comes to a strip of grass in Golden Gate Park. If you can manage it, you should ride there. The tour is run by volunteers from the S.F. Bike Coalition and sponsored by New Belgium Brewing, and all the bike people turn out for the bike parade, the rodeo, and pedal-friendly bands. Everyone goes away happy, some with new One More Bike T-shirts, and you won't even have to spit self-righteous venom or mass in an intersection on the way home.
